Hotel Ulysses is a place where wanderers from anywhere can come for one-of-a-kind experiences – whether they are popping out of their Baltimore studio for a drink or need a place to stay during their East Coast tour. To venture into Baltimore’s rich history and vibrant community by way of the landmark Latrobe building feels only natural — an icon with a checkered past that has been restored to carry on its legacy. Nestled into the neighborhood of Mt. Vernon, the sprawling site houses 116 guest rooms alongside Blooms, an eccentric cocktail lounge, and Ash-Bar, a salon-style café. Far from a support for tourists, Ulysses stands firm as a contributor and tableau vivant of Baltimore’s artistic tradition–and its contemporary evolution.


About the role

The Morning Front of House Lead is responsible for supporting smooth morning operations across the front of house. This role acts as the point person for the AM team by helping ensure staff arrive on time, service standards are followed, orders are checked in and put away properly, and the floor is supported throughout service.

This position is a working lead role, meaning the AM FOH Lead should be comfortable assisting as a server, support staff, host, runner, or general floor support as needed. The role carries a higher hourly wage due to the added operational responsibility and accountability.
